Understanding Acid Reflux and GORD
Acid reflux occurs when stomach acid flows back into the oesophagus, causing symptoms such as heartburn, regurgitation, and chest pain. When acid reflux happens frequently or causes complications, it may be diagnosed as gastro-oesophageal reflux disease (GORD). Common triggers include certain foods, alcohol, smoking, stress, and being overweight.
Prescription treatments like Omeprazole work by blocking the proton pumps in the stomach lining, significantly reducing acid production. This allows the oesophagus to heal and prevents further acid damage. Most patients notice improvement within 1-2 days of starting treatment, with maximum benefit typically achieved after 4 weeks of consistent use.
Treatment Duration and Safety
The duration of acid reflux treatment varies depending on your condition severity and response to medication. Short courses of 4-8 weeks are often prescribed initially, though some patients may require longer-term maintenance therapy. Lifestyle Management Alongside Treatment
While prescription medication effectively manages acid reflux symptoms, combining treatment with lifestyle modifications often provides the best results. Consider eating smaller, more frequent meals, avoiding trigger foods, maintaining a healthy weight, and elevating the head of your bed. If you experience persistent symptoms despite treatment, or develop new symptoms such as difficulty swallowing, unexplained weight loss, or persistent vomiting, it's important to seek further medical evaluation.
